Расшифровка почты с python - PullRequest
       52

Расшифровка почты с python

0 голосов
/ 30 апреля 2020

Мне нужно получить почту. Используя imaplib, я получаю объект байтов. Если я декодирую его с помощью UTF-8, я получаю сообщение, разделенное на две части:

------=_Part_327394_2100449045.1588265266667
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: base64

и

------=_Part_327394_2100449045.1588265266667
Content-Type: text/html; charset=UTF-8
Content-Transfer-Encoding: quoted-printable

, и ни одна из них не выглядит чем-то значимым (возможно, потому что mail содержит нелатинские символы) Попытка расшифровать его с помощью base64 не сработала - utf-8 не может ничего декодировать после этого. Итак, как мне получить текст?

...